Necessary Ingredients:

  • Sugar – 250 gr;
  • Powdered milk -125 gr;
  • Cocoa powder – 35 gr;
  • Water – 75 ml;
  • Butter – 50 gr.

Clear Instruction

Pour filtered water into a saucepan. Tap water – not in any case, as it will give the dessert an unpleasant aftertaste. Then you need to add sugar and mix. By the way, you can replace it with cane or add a sweetener that is not afraid of heat treatment. For flavor, add a couple of drops of vanilla essence (according to the instructions). Place the saucepan over medium heat, bring the syrup to a boil and completely dissolve the sugar crystals. At the same time, you need to stir constantly.

In a separate container, mix milk powder with cocoa powder. Post, pour the prepared dry mixture into the hot sugar syrup and mix the mass thoroughly until smooth so that there are no lumps. Then add the softened butter and stir until the butter is completely melted.

The prepared form – a tray or a dish – must be covered with oiled baking paper or cling film. You can simply grease the mold with a piece of butter. After that, pour the chocolate mass and with a knife, greased with butter, level the surface.

Chocolate solidifies well at room temperature, but for a firmer consistency and similarity to familiar chocolate, it should be refrigerated. Cut the cooled chocolate into any figures, with a slightly damp, but not wet, sharp knife.

Roasted almonds, peanuts, hazelnuts, cashews or walnuts dried in a dry frying pan can be added to the liquid chocolate mass. You can add a handful of dried raspberries, cherries or steamed raisins.
